In the rapidly evolving world of software development, feature flagging has emerged as a crucial practice for managing the rollout of new features, enabling safer deployments, and enhancing continuous delivery. As businesses strive for agility and innovation, selecting the right feature flagging tool becomes paramount. This article explores the top 10 feature flagging tools in France for 2025, highlighting their unique features, benefits, and overall impact on development teams.
1. LaunchDarkly
LaunchDarkly is a leader in the feature flagging space, offering robust tools that allow developers to deploy, control, and monitor features in real-time. With its strong API support and integrations with popular platforms, LaunchDarkly enables teams to test new features in production environments with minimal risk. The platform’s analytics and targeting capabilities provide insights into user behavior and feature adoption.
2. Split.io
Split.io combines feature flagging with powerful analytics, making it ideal for teams that prioritize data-driven decision-making. Its ability to track feature performance and user engagement helps businesses optimize their rollout strategies. Split.io also supports A/B testing, allowing teams to experiment with different features and configurations seamlessly.
3. Optimizely
Known primarily for its A/B testing capabilities, Optimizely also offers a comprehensive feature flagging solution. The platform allows teams to manage feature releases effectively, targeting specific user segments and analyzing the impact of new features. Optimizely’s user-friendly interface and extensive documentation make it accessible for teams of all sizes.
4. FeatureFlow
FeatureFlow is a French-based feature flagging tool that emphasizes simplicity and ease of use. It provides a straightforward interface for managing flags and offers integration with various CI/CD pipelines. FeatureFlow’s focus on collaboration helps teams coordinate better and streamline their development processes.
5. Flagsmith
Flagsmith is an open-source feature flagging platform that provides flexibility and control to development teams. With its self-hosted option, organizations can maintain data privacy while utilizing powerful feature management tools. Flagsmith supports remote configurations and has a strong API for custom integrations.
6. Unleash
Unleash is another open-source feature flagging solution that is gaining popularity in France. It features a simple yet effective dashboard for managing flags and provides various strategies for targeting users. Unleash focuses on performance and scalability, making it suitable for large enterprises and startups alike.
7. CloudBees Feature Management
CloudBees, known for its continuous delivery solutions, also offers a feature flagging tool that integrates seamlessly with its existing products. This tool allows organizations to manage feature releases across different environments and provides detailed reporting capabilities to track the success of new features.
8. Togglz
Togglz is a Java-based feature flagging framework that is particularly popular among Java developers. It provides a simple and effective way to manage feature flags within Java applications. Togglz offers a web console for managing flags and integrates well with existing CI/CD processes.
9. Flipt
Flipt is a modern feature flagging tool designed for developers seeking simplicity and ease of use. It offers a clean interface and easy integration with various programming languages. Flipt supports feature toggles, remote configurations, and user segmentation, making it a versatile choice for many organizations.
10. Rollout.io
Rollout.io is a powerful feature flagging solution that focuses on enhancing user experience through gradual feature rollouts. Its advanced targeting and segmentation capabilities allow teams to ensure that only the right users see new features. Rollout.io also provides detailed analytics on feature performance and user feedback.
Conclusion
As the demand for faster and safer software releases continues to grow, feature flagging tools have become indispensable for development teams in France. The tools listed above not only enhance workflow efficiency but also empower teams to make data-driven decisions about feature rollouts. Whether you are a small startup or a large enterprise, selecting the right feature flagging tool can significantly impact your development process and overall product success.
FAQ
What is feature flagging?
Feature flagging is a software development practice that allows developers to enable or disable features in an application without deploying new code. This enables safer testing and gradual rollouts of new functionalities.
Why is feature flagging important?
Feature flagging is important because it allows teams to test features in production, reduce deployment risks, and gather user feedback before fully launching a feature. This leads to improved software quality and user satisfaction.
Can feature flags be used for A/B testing?
Yes, feature flags can be used for A/B testing by allowing teams to deploy multiple variations of a feature to different user segments. This enables data collection and analysis of user interactions with each variation, helping teams make informed decisions.
Are there open-source feature flagging tools?
Yes, several open-source feature flagging tools are available, such as Unleash and Flagsmith. These tools provide flexibility and can be customized to meet specific organizational needs.
How do I choose the right feature flagging tool?
When choosing a feature flagging tool, consider factors such as ease of use, integration capabilities, analytics features, and support for A/B testing. Assessing your team’s specific needs and workflows will help you select the most suitable option.
Related Analysis: View Previous Industry Report